Remembering some vague positive thoughts towards Building The State’s debut full-length, I bought Faces In The Architecture on a bit of a whim. It has turned out to be one of the best decisions I have made this year. The band has made a giant leap forward in their songwriting with this immaculately constructed four song EP. Much like Moving Mountains, who I reviewed earlier this year, Building The State are setting up camp somewhere between emo and post rock. At times on Faces In The Architecture I am reminded of the earlier Velvet Teen material. But, once again like Moving Mountains, the band Building The State so closely resembles are the great Appleseed Cast.

Three songs on Faces In The Architecture showcase the band employing vocals more liberally than on their first album. The third song returns the band to the pure instrumental rock that bares a striking resemblance to Explosions In The Sky. What Building The State does so well, regardless of whether or not vocals appear, is at creating a uniform mood. These four songs flow so remarkably well together over the span of this 19 minute EP. When the vocals do appear they never overtake the music. The vocals only compliment the musical landscape the band creates. The four songs here add up to more than the sum of their parts. That is never an easy accomplishment for an album, much less an EP. Building The State not only make it happen, they perfect it. The band is about to head into the studio to record their second full-length record. Hopefully, Faces In The Architecture is only a small indication of the greatness that lies ahead.

RIYL: The Appleseed Cast, Explosions In The Sky, Moving Mountains
